TURN-208: Gatevale turnstile counters at the Merrow Field pilot double-count when a rotation reverses mid-cycle. Attendance totals drift roughly 2% high per event. The debounce window fix is implemented, reviewed by Ilsa, and soak-tested across two simulated match days without drift. Ready for your cut; the candidate build is identified below.

trace token, tagag-tafog: htk6_5ed18c

# Building Access: Changing Room Lockers — Ashgate Depot

Contractors working at Ashgate Depot may use the ground-floor changing rooms. Lockers 1–20 are reserved for Norbeck staff; visiting contractors take any locker numbered 21 or above. Bring your own padlock or borrow one from the site office. Lockers must be emptied at the end of each visit. The changing-room door accepts the code below.

staff pass of kawip-hawef = bdg-QLP-2

Subject: Quickstore 4.2 — bloom filter now fronts the KV layer

Plugin authors: starting with this release, Quickstore places a bloom filter ahead of the key-value store. Negative lookups return faster; false positives fall through safely. No API changes are required on your side. Verify your plugin against the staging build referenced below.

session token of fahif-tadup = htk3_9c7

Key ceremony checklist — item 4: Mailhopper bounce processor. Before rotating the signing key for the Mailhopper bounce queue, confirm both custodians (Darla and Priyesh) are present and the Tungsten HSM is in ceremony mode. Verify the bounce classifier has drained its retry backlog, then export the sealed key bundle to the offline ledger. Record the ceremony timestamp in the Fennwick runbook. Once the bundle is sealed, note the recovery passphrase below for escrow.

strongbox words: kelix-rusael-fravan-tameth-briax-fraael-praiel